Welcome back to another Color My Heart Color Dare challenge blog post!  This week we are challenging you to combine these three Close to My Heart colors:  Pixie, Pansy and Emerald.  Black and White Daisy are always FREE to use in our challenges but please do not add any new colors.  Of course, if you don't have these exclusive Close to My Heart colors yet you may substitute similar colors so you can still join in on the fun!

Months ago I seriously considered purchasing a Quilt Block Die from Stampin' Up.  It was pricey and I reluctantly talked myself out of the purchase.  Quilting is also another craft passion of mine so I decided that I could create a similar look in Cricut's Design Space and I did just that.  



Although it is not quite "perfect" I am very pleased with how it came out with these fabulous bright and cheery colors.  Now that I have it in my Design Space files I can replicate, resize and reproduce it in numerous color schemes. What fun I'm going to have with this file*!
